titleOfInvention | CATALYSED REACTION MIXTURE AND ITS USE IN THE CONTROLLED EVALUATION OF COATINGS |
abstract | The invention relates to a catalyzed reaction mixture in which a hydroxyl compound is reacted with an isocyanate. Preferably, an activatable catalyst is used to harden a coating composition of a polyol and a polyisocyanate. The activatable catalyst is activated in the presence of an amine activator or by heating and comprises the reaction product of a metal catalyst, namely a tin catalyst, a bismuth catalyst or a mixture thereof, and a molar excess of a complexing agent. The complexing agent is a mercapto compound, a polyphenol reactive with an isocyanate group in the presence of an amine activator, or a mixture thereof. A single polyol resin can contain both the complexing agent and the activatable catalyst.
